There is a one-off connection fee of £750 charged by OR so £3900 sounds about right for a band E install - mine was £3700 for band D.

Wrt monthly costs, I imagine bt Wholesale bandwidth and Openreach wholesale costs make up a large chunk of the £320 monthly fee. Decent support also isn't cheap, you will find Fluidone are very pro-active in keeping you up to date with build progress should you place an order with them.
